Am interested in identifying this paperweight. It was purchased in a shop somewhere in the vicinity of Dunkeld/Perth in 1996. I suspect it is a miniature pressed millefiori made by Perthshire Paperweights. Unfortunately the label was removed leaving just the adhesive (see photo). Apologises for the photo qualities.
